What is the strategy of LEGO?

  • The LEGO Group's mission is to inspire and develop the builders of tomorrow through the power of play.
  • The LEGO System in Play, with its foundation in LEGO bricks, allows children and fans to build and rebuild anything they can imagine.

Does LEGO use differentiation strategy?

  • The LEGO group is using the differentiation strategy as the company states, "we want to be the best, not the biggest."
  • In addition to that, the company is focusing on new product development along with innovation as well.

Why is LEGO so successful?

  • Instead of offering kids ready-made toys, LEGO gives them the opportunity to build their toys — a much more challenging activity which kept kids engaged for hours.
  • The LEGO System of Play becomes very successful and the company starts selling it to other countries.

The matrix organizational structure is atypical as it brings together employees and managers of different departments to work towards achieving a goal. The matrix structure is a combination of functional and division structures. The first divides departments within a company of developed functions, while the second divides them by products, customers or geographic location. Small business owners must understand the benefits and limitations of the matrix structure before implementing it in their businesses.

Multi-factor productivity (MFP) measures or determines the productivity or efficiency of a production process by comparing it to the the amount of invested multi-factor inputs (labor, materials, energy, capital).

In other words, Multi-factor productivity (MFP) also known as total factor productivity (TFP) is an economic performance determination of the number of goods produced when compared to inputs (labor, materials, energy, capital).
